I'm not sure I'm ever going to gut another critter in my life. Or at least elk and moose. Tried the gutless method twice in December on two bull moose.

We had the first moose in the truck in 1.25 hrs (short calf sled ride).

Couple days later, the closest we could get the truck to the bull was about 500yds. Just skin, cut the legs off, trim off the backstraps, tenderloin, brisket, and any rib or neck meat possible. So 4 legs, a bag of meat, and the head in the 2 calf sleds and out in one trip. Sweet! May use on deer shot in coulees too. We'll see.
